Double pane windows are called insulation glass units. They consist of two panes that are separated by a spacer, and sometimes an air layer to help with insulation. These windows are typical in the majority of homes, and they are an excellent option to improve energy efficiency. They can fail because of inadequate seals between the frame and the glass. In such cases condensation can form between the panes, leading to a loss in energy efficiency.

Double-pane windows consist of two glass panes that are separated from one another by a gap, which can be filled with insulation gas, such as argon. The argon gas provides an airtight seal that keeps out cold and heat from the outside. Double-pane windows are generally more expensive than single-pane windows however, the cost is offset by their energy efficiency. A damaged window may indicate that the airtight sealing is broken. This can result in moisture accumulation and freeze during cold weather. The moisture that is trapped between the windows can result in condensation, which makes your home uncomfortable and drives up the cost of your energy bill.
